long-headed
(long-head-ed)
3 syllables
Definition
adjective. 1 having a dolichocephalic head; 2 of great discernment or foresight; farseeing or shrewd
Example Sentence
He spotted a longheaded eagle ray. OR His long-headed planning led to success.
Synonyms
Antonyms
brachycephalic; short-sighted
